New better at home report released

Everycare Eastbourne are pleased to announce the release of a new updated version of the “better at home” report.

This report has been commissioned by Everycare along with members of the live in care hub to provide factual information about the way live in care can impact on the health and well being of the elderly when comparing it to residential care (such as a nursing home) in order to help the public understand exactly what live in care is and what it can achieve.

Nicola Small Everycare Eastbourne’s branch manager said “we are seeing that live in care is becoming a more recognised service with all the health benefits and often financial savings it can bring to clients wishing to remain in their own homes”
